How does adaptability benefit community managers?

Adaptability is a crucial trait for community managers because it enables them to effectively respond to the evolving needs of community members. As communities grow and develop, the interests, preferences, and requirements of members can change significantly. For instance, community managers may encounter sudden shifts in member engagement levels, changes in feedback regarding community initiatives, or emerging trends that members are interested in.

Being adaptable means that community managers can assess these changes and adjust their strategies, communication approaches, and activities accordingly. This responsiveness fosters a sense of belonging and support within the community, as members feel their needs are acknowledged and met. It ultimately leads to higher engagement rates, member satisfaction, and overall community success.
